Banque Française Commerciale Océan Indien
The Banque Française Commerciale Océan Indien (BFC) is a bank with a long history, having been established in 1960. It's a subsidiary of the Société Générale.
BFC's headquarters are located in Saint-Denis, France, and it has a significant presence in the southern Indian Ocean region, specifically on the islands of La Réunion and Mayotte. Its main objective is to provide financial services to individuals and businesses in these territories.
As of 2022, Ludovic Cailly is the current director of BFC. The bank has a total of 400 employees, who work hard to ensure that its customers receive the best possible service.
BFC is a significant player in the financial sector, with a wide range of services offered, including financial intermediation. Its parent company is the Société Générale, which holds a significant stake in the bank.

BFC's slogan is "C'est vous l'avenir", which roughly translates to "You are the future". This reflects the bank's commitment to supporting the development of the region and its people.
BFC's code banque (BIC) is BFCOFRPP, and its code établissement (IBAN) is 18719. These codes are used for international transactions and identification purposes.
